Plot details for Captain America 3

August 6, 2014 by admin

Ahead of the Blu-ray and DVD release of Captain America: The Winter Soldier in a couple of weeks, Joe and Anthony Russo sat down with Yahoo! to talk about their plans for the as-of-yet-untitled Captain America 3, which is set to be released on May 6th 2016, the same day as Batman v Superman: Dawn of Justice.

Spoilers for Captain America: The Winter Soldier, obviously.

The directing duo said that the movie will take place “two years” after Captain America: The Winter Soldier and will centre around Steve Rogers’ relationship with Bucky Barnes, aka The Winter Soldier. “The character was invented for an explicitly political purpose. So it’s hard to get away from that nature,” Anthony said. Joe added that it was important for them to make sure Captain America does not become too disillusioned anti-hero, “his morality is part of his superpower.”

“[We’re] bringing some new elements to the table that will give us a twist on Winter Soldier“, the pair concluded.

With Chris Evans’ contract coming to an end with Avengers 3, does this mean they’ll be passing the Captain America mantle to Bucky or The Falcon as they have recently in the comics? You can read the thoughts of Anthony Mackie (who plays The Falcon in Captain America: The Winter Soldier) on this subject here.

The Russo Brothers will also be directing several episodes of Agent Carter, which is set to debut in January 2015.

Captain America 3 is set for release on May 6th 2016 and will presumably see Chris Evans reprise his role as Captain America alongside Anthony Mackie as The Falcon, Sebastian Stan as The Winter Soldier, Scarlett Johansson as Black Widow and Samuel L. Jackson as Nick Fury.
